Transaction 0880038cc8fef99dd1624ddad597526ca6e338b377691a562866cf030d544a29
1 Input
1 Output
-
0880038cc8fef99dd1624ddad597526ca6e338b377691a562866cf030d544a29:0
- value
- 12060389
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 30bcdc560f7e6204866bf337ea6e17493e76c65a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15ShgUkkiZWppHXHz1ikKDbfWwDkouJReC